I've never used a lightsabre before, but as a martial artist with swords, dual and double sided pikes each has an advantage.
First the single sword, this should be used by a person who intends to use brute force as it can be held with two hand gather all the person's strength. Take note that because of this it would be very hard to knock the sabre from this person's hands. So this could take a battering of harsh direct blows.
2nd the dual sabres, should be used by a defensive fighter. With the ability to block more incoming attacking with greater speed you'd just have to wait until the other person to foul up, and yes this would be the best defense from blaster fire, note that a strong blow could batter down the defense but then again watch for their other sabre coming at you.
Last the double sided sabre, a weapon of speed, agility and acorbates. the best thing about this is it could easily defend your whole body from harm with some aility you could altogther avoid most attacks while send in your own attacks, it's a vastly offensive weapon.
As for people not dying in one shot from a lightsabre, striking in full a person with no armor should result in death however, what of jedi or sith that can absord energy?
I don't see how one fast inaccurate blow could kill a jedi at any rate the range of motion in fast stance is little more than a flick of the wrists, they's make only glancing wounds like you seen Dooku give Obi-wan in episode 2.
Medium stance would make wounds bad enough that the person would lose most use of the area he was struck in, however in fast or medium stance a head shot would kill unless the energy source was absorbed.
In short all of these have advantages and disadvantages, it's really who's more skilled in the stances and weapons he or she picks that should decide the winner. Jedi CANNOT absorb energy in the way you mean and any reasonable stroke in the lightest of stances would finish a fight. ALL lightsabre fights end when the other person is hit, not when he is hit HARD.
Double sabre usage is problematic at best and in no way superior to single blade fighting which is the most devastating swordfighting form. Two sabres are a nightmare to co-ordinate, and impede each other. But it is, at least, practical...
...because as has been discussed elsewhere, the double-bladed sabre would, in real life, be a DREADFUL weapon. And it is actually the LEAST suitable weapon for protecting yourself because of its vast vulnerable point at the hilt, and because it is a hafted weapon that you can only hold in the middle which massively impedes its use, and you cannot perform nearly all the basic guards with it as you would hack yourself in half trying to do so.
Reality aside, the thematic point remains that the greatest sabre fighters in the films use a SINGLE-BLADED SABRE. And the choice of such a weapon should NOT be dwarved by exotic types.
